I got this after I suffered a broken top LCD on my Nikon D800. I bike about 8000 miles a year, nearly always with the D800 tossed into the saddlebag on my bicycle. It took a little tugging and hauling to get the skin onto the camera, and a little getting used to when it comes to locating the various control buttons. The buttons on the skin have the icons molded into them, but are black-on-black, so it's hard to see which is which, except in bright light. After a while, you get so you just hit the buttons by instinct, so it's a learning curve issue. The skin comes with a protective plastic cover for the rear LCD, which is redundant since I've already got Nikon's cover on it, but a little more protection doesn't hurt. There's another piece of clear plastic packaged with the skin, with no explanation of what it's for. I decided to cut a piece of it to fit over the top LCD--cut the piece enough oversize so it fits under the skin to keep it in place. So far, this has protected that top LCD. Overall, this is a very good product. It does add a bit of bulk to the already sizable chassis of the D800, but the silicone rubber provides a very secure grip, really helps reduce the chance of dropping the camera when grabbing it casually, one-handed. And, of course, the rubber would provide a decent amount of cushioning if you did happen to drop it. The fit on the camera is perfect, with the exception that the flap that goes into the accessory shoe tends to slip out--not a big problem.

I have been using gaffers tape to de-badge my D800 now with this skin the only thing I have to cover is the Nikon on the front of the pop up flash. So for this purpose it is perfect. Be aware that the added thickness will affect the grip. If you have small hands this might be an issue but for me the grip still felt good. The material was thick, durable, and easily installed with a body cap on the camera. I had just installed a screen protector so I did not install the one that came with the skin so the fit isn't as good as with it (the skin has a groove to connect to the screen protector) but I still don't have any issues with the skin staying in place. My complaints are the skin slips into the hot shoe and if you leave it out the skin is pretty loose...so I am stuck removing and re-attaching when I need the hot shoe. All doors and the batteries are accessible without removing the skin, but the skin does interfere with my tripod quick release plate attachment (Manfrotto RC2) so that you either have to put it on crooked with the skin sandwiched or move the skin out of the way. Overall this is a good product with only a few items to watch out for.

Snug-It Pro camera skins provide complete protection for digital SLR cameras. Heavy duty for heavy use, they are custom molded for a glove-like fit. All buttons, dials, sensors and compartments are carefully molded over and around for a completely functional and rugged skin.
Thicker silicone provides added protection and ridges molded into the skin allow for a better grip on the larger cameras. Whether you are a professional photographer or a first-time digital SLR buyer, Snug-it Pro skins are perfect for anyone looking for complete camera protection.
